For our reverse engineering project, we chose to use the smoke detector. This smoke detector consists of a sensor to detect smoke and a loud electronic buzzer to alert people within the building.

    • Use a screwdriver to pry open the plastic enclosure. It might be easier to push the buzzer through the hole, if you need extra leverage.

    • The buzzer is unhooked from the PCB board, by hands.

    • This is the circuit for the smoke detector. It is powered by a 9V battery. The 3 metal leafs are contacts for the buzzer and the bigger leaf is for the test button.

    • The metal cap is removed to reveal a, MC145017, driver chip and americium sensor. Do not remove americium from the sensor!
